保存成功
保存失败,请重试
提交成功

史上最全 Redis 面试题及答案,搞懂这套题征服面试官

作者/分享人:ilomilo
4年开发经验,精通数据结构和算法,精通web框架源码(spring、mybatis、webflux等),精通中间件的最佳实践和源码,精通分布式技术

Redis 学的怎么样,都来看下这套题检验下吧。小编总结了下自己面试时遇到的 Redis 面试题和网上普遍的面试题,然后做了下总结,从基础、高级知识点、再到集群、运维、方案。然后总结了下怎么回答才会让面试官满意。

本场 Chat 包含以下面试题:

  1. Redis 相比 memcached 有哪些优势
  2. Redis 支持那几种数据结构,底层原理解释一下
  3. Redis 有哪几种数据淘汰策略
  4. 一个字符串类型的值能存储最大容量是多少
  5. Redis 集群方案应该怎么做,有哪些方案
  6. Redis 集群方案什么情况下会导致整个集群不可用
  7. Redis 和 Redisson 有什么关系
  8. Redis 与 Redisson 对比有什么优缺点
  9. Redis 如何设置密码及验证密码
  10. 解释下 Redis 哈希槽的概念
  11. 解释下 Redis 的主从复制模型
  12. Redis 集群会有写操作丢失吗,为什么
  13. Redis 集群之间是如何复制的
  14. Redis 集群最大节点个数是多少
  15. Redis 中管道有什么用
  16. 怎么理解 Redis 事务,Redis 事务相关的命令有哪几个
  17. Redis key 的过期时间和永久有效分别怎么设置
  18. Redis 如何做内存优化
  19. Redis 回收进程如何工作的
  20. Redis 回收内存使用的什么算法
  21. Redis 如何做大量数据插入
  22. 为什么要做 Redis 分区,有哪些 Redis 分区实现方案,Redis 分区有什么缺点
  23. Redis 持久化数据和缓存怎么做扩容
  24. 分布式 Redis 是前期做还是后期规模上来了再做好,为什么
  25. Twemproxy 是什么
  26. Redis 的内存占用情况怎么样
  27. 都有哪些办法可以降低 Redis 的内存使用情况呢
  28. Redis 的内存用完了会发生什么
  29. Redis 是单线程的,如何提高多核 CPU 的利用率
  30. Redis 是单线程的是怎么做到高并发的
  31. 一个 Redis 实例最多能存放多少的 keys,List、Set、Sorted Set 最多能存放多少元素
  32. Redis 常见性能问题和解决方案
  33. Redis 提供了哪几种持久化方式,如何选择合适的持久化方式
  34. 修改配置不重启 Redis 会实事生效吗
  35. 数据库和 Redis 缓存双写不一致的问题怎么解决的
  36. Redis 的过期策略怎么设计比较合理
  37. 发生缓存雪崩、缓存击穿、缓存穿透的问题分别有什么解决方案
  38. 缓存预热、缓存热备、缓存降级的高可用技术手段了解吗
  39. 如何提高 Redis 服务的缓存命中率
活动取消
已有507人预订
预订达标
文章出炉
     
09月19日
10月23日
退款保证:
• 09月19日前,预订人数未达标,您将获得全额退款。
• 作者未按时完成文章,您将获得全额退款。
你可能还喜欢
如何依靠副业赚钱,应对人到中年的职场危机
代码GG陆晓明
数据结构算法常见的 100 道面试题全解析:2019 版
攻城狮
怎样的一份“副业”,能让你不依赖“死工资”?
一尘
Redis 面试题全解析
驰骋
送卫衣:GitChat 1024 留言有奖活动来啦!
GitChat 内容组
Redis 难题突破,最经典 36 题含详细解析
慕容千语
【有奖活动】用一句话证明你是程序员
🐡赵小胖
Zookeeper 详解与实践,你面试工作都绕不开的必考题!
latent
前端 MVVM 模式中的数据层(Model)实战应用
Think.
VSCode 使用教程:使用好的工具提高你的工作效率
暖和狐狸
详解 Google Protocol Buffer 协议
拾贝壳的人
大白话聊技术之 Redis 秒杀系统的设计与实现
咔咔
让架构师和研发团队争论了 10 分钟的简单事务问题
zaqweb
线程池原理及优化
ilomilo
深度学习必备之高等数学知识加油站
奔跑的小米
微信扫描登录
关注提示×
扫码关注公众号,获得 Chat 最新进展通知!
入群与作者交流×
扫码后回复关键字 入群
Chat·作者交流群
入群码
该二维码永久有效